How to Install Front Wiper Blades 2011-19 Ford Explorer

Created on: 2018-10-08

How to repair, install, fix, change or replace a damaged, bent, or failing windshield wiper blade on 11 Ford Explorer

  1. step 1 :Replacing the Front Wiper Blade
    • Pry up on the tab on the wiper blade
    • Pry it out
    • Line up the new blade
    • Press it in place

All right. So, we have the new blade. I'm going to make sure it matches. It's the same length and underneath here I'm gonna use a straight blade screwdriver and I have to pry underneath here to pry this out and slide it off. It's a little bit tricky the way this set up is.

Take the new blade. You're going to slide this little tab in this slot here just like that and we're gonna just press it on. Just like that. Lock it in place. Make sure it's good and tight and you're good to go.
